Democratic Rep. Marie Gluesenkamp Perez and Republican Sen. John Braun will proceed to the general election for Washington’s 3rd Congressional District, following a nonpartisan primary. They outpaced seven other candidates, with the race deemed crucial for determining control of the House next year.

Estonia’s President Alar Karis expressed confidence in the US honouring NATO’s Article 5 during an interview with Euronews, despite concerns over transatlantic tensions under President Trump. He urged Europe to enhance its defence capabilities, avoiding the testing of collective security commitments.
